Sarah Coffman Morris, 86, of Ronceverte, WV, passed quietly on Wednesday, January 1, 2020, at The Brier after an extended illness.
She was born on February 22, 1933, in Greenbrier County, WV, to Harold and Marie Richeson Coffman.
She graduated from Greenbrier High School, class of 1951. Sarah had worked at Barr’s Store in Lewisburg, WV, for a number of years. She then worked at Greenbrier Valley Bank until her retirement after 30 years of service. In retirement, she and her husband, Roy, enjoyed traveling all across the country with many members of the community.
She was a member of Lewisburg United Methodist Church for many years before transferring her membership to Trinity United Methodist Church in Ronceverte. She was active in the United Methodist Women’s Circle, serving in numerous capacities. Her generosity to the church and the larger community will be fondly remembered.
She was a past Worthy Matron of the Order of the Eastern Star Chapter # 108, of which she was a member for nearly half a century.
Other than her parents, she was preceded in death by her brothers, Richard and John; and a sister, Hallie Bland.
Left to cherish her memory are her husband, Roy Morris of Ronceverte; stepdaughters, Angie Morris (Sam Massie) of Ronceverte and Brenda Austin (Shawn) of Huntersville, NC; stepson, Alan Morris (Karen) of Lewisburg; grandchildren, Tiffany Steele (Chris) of Lewisburg and Ethan Morris (Lauren), also of Lewisburg; a very special great-granddaughter, Rhylee Steele, whom she loved to spoil; two great-grandsons, Izaak and Elijah Morris; her sister, Nellie Tuckwiller of Asbury, WV; and numerous nieces and nephews.
